hero
How2Go
Balaghat to Maihar

Balaghat to Maihar

Maihar is approximately 250+ kms from Balaghat. The fastest way to reach Maihar from Balaghat is by Train. It takes approximately 6 hours. The cheapest way to reach Maihar from Balaghat is by Train which would take approximately 6 hours.

Sort By
Mode of Transport

Direct Train

RECOMMENDED

CHEAPEST

FASTEST

Balaghat

Maihar

Approx Travel Time

5h 45m

₹230

Onwards

Via Jabalpur

Balaghat

Jabalpur

Maihar

Approx Travel Time

7h 25m

₹230

Onwards

Balaghat

Jabalpur

Maihar

Approx Travel Time

8h 10m

₹383

Onwards

Balaghat

Jabalpur

Maihar

Approx Travel Time

8h 10m

₹435

Onwards

Balaghat

Jabalpur

Maihar

Approx Travel Time

8h 55m

₹588

Onwards

Balaghat

Jabalpur

Maihar

Approx Travel Time

9h 53m

₹6,089

Onwards

Balaghat

Jabalpur

Maihar

Approx Travel Time

10h 38m

₹6,242

Onwards

Ads by MMT

Via Katni

Balaghat

Katni

Maihar

Approx Travel Time

7h 25m

₹255

Onwards

Via Gondia

Balaghat

Gondia

Maihar

Approx Travel Time

9h 10m

₹390

Onwards

Balaghat

Gondia

Maihar

Approx Travel Time

9h 25m

₹310

Onwards

Ads by MMT

Frequently Asked Questions

What is the distance between Balaghat and Maihar?

Maihar is approximately 250+ kms from Balaghat.

How long does it take to reach Maihar from Balaghat?

It takes approximately 6 hours to reach Maihar from Balaghat by Train.

What is the cheapest way to reach Maihar from Balaghat?

The cheapest way to reach Maihar from Balaghat is by Train.

What is the fastest way to reach Maihar from Balaghat?

The fastest way to reach Maihar from Balaghat is by Train.

twitterfacebook

© 2024 MAKEMYTRIP PVT. LTD.

Country India